Dear teammates, I am Sister Qinglan. In today's early trading session, the market has been influenced by two significant pieces of news. On one hand, the US military's raid on Iran has sharply increased geopolitical risks, suppressing risk assets and putting significant pressure on BTC; on the other hand, tech stocks are experiencing record sell-offs, with funds rapidly taking profits, which may further affect the cryptocurrency market. These two negative factors combined have led to BTC wavering around $64,200, with increasing divergence between bulls and bears. In today's article, Sister Qinglan will use data to help you understand the current situation and find the most prudent trading strategy.

The current time is July 30, 09:46, and BTC is quoted at 64,200 USDT. Let's start by looking at the multi-timeframe status to quickly locate market rhythm.

On the daily chart, the price is struggling between MA5 and MA30, the MACD DIF line has crossed below the zero axis, and the histogram continues to shorten, indicating a depletion of bullish momentum. RSI is around 52, which is in a neutral to weak area. The 4-hour chart has shown some positive signals, the MACD histogram has turned from negative to positive, and the DIF line is starting to turn upwards, suggesting a preliminary form of bottom divergence, but the price is still suppressed by MA30, limiting the rebound strength. The 1-hour chart is the core battlefield of today; the price is operating below EMA55, MACD is below the zero axis, and RSI is around 46, with bears holding the initiative. The 15-minute chart indicates a short-term need for a rebound, with MACD showing a golden cross and RSI climbing back to 56, but the strength is not strong, indicating a technical correction after overselling.

Overall, the larger timeframe leans bearish while the smaller timeframe shows a demand for a rebound. The market is in a phase of oscillation and bottoming out, and directional choices are imminent.

Next, we will use the Qinglan TPV system to verify the signals. The core rule is that the 1-hour EMA55 serves as the dividing line between bulls and bears, with the current EMA55 at $64,110. Among the last 8 hourly candlesticks, there have only been 2 instances where the closing price was above EMA55, and it has crossed it 2 times, with the price’s absolute range from EMA55 being 0.14%, indicating a near-line fluctuation, which increases the probability of oscillation. According to system rules, it currently does not meet the threshold for a unilateral trend, nor does it satisfy the strict definition of an oscillating market, placing it in a gray area.

Specifically, looking at the short-selling conditions. First, the price is pressured below the 1-hour EMA55; the last two candlestick closing prices were 64,150 and 64,200, both below EMA55's 64,110, satisfying the condition. Second, there is a resistance formation; a long upper shadow appeared around 64,300 on the hourly chart, showing heavy selling pressure above. Third, the rebound lacks strength; although the MACD histogram is shortening, the DIF and DEA remain below the zero axis, and the RSI has slightly rebounded from 46, without adequate strength. The conditions for short-selling are mainly met but caution is required due to the rebound risk from the 4-hour bottom divergence.

Regarding the conditions for going long, the price has not yet stabilized above EMA55, the supporting stabilization form is not clear, and while there are signs of depletion in downward momentum, there is no clear bullish engulfing or bottom divergence formation. Therefore, the conditions for going long are not met, and it is not advisable to actively catch the bottom at this time.

On-chain data shows that the fear and greed index has fallen to 28, in the fear zone, indicating extremely pessimistic market sentiment, which is often a characteristic of a temporary bottom. The BTC market share remains at 56.44%, indicating that funds are still seeking safety in BTC and have not significantly flowed into altcoins. In terms of liquidity, the tech stock sell-off and geopolitical risks have intensified risk-averse sentiment, with gold breaking through $4,100, but BTC has not risen in sync, indicating that the cryptocurrency market is still under pressure from tightening liquidity.

The key defensive and offensive positions are: the first resistance position above is the 1-hour EMA55 at $64,110, and the second resistance position is the 4-hour MA30 at $64,293, breaking through here will open up a rebound space. The first support position below is $63,800, which is a dense trading area on the 15-minute chart; the second support position is $63,500, a break below this will accelerate the decline.
